不创建Paypal账户的情况下使用Paypal标准支付

13

我想销售媒体,并选择PayPal支付标准来完成交易。

根据官方文档,买家可以在没有PayPal帐户的情况下进行购买。只需输入卡号/CVC、姓名和其他一些字段即可购买。

但是当我点击使用Paypal按钮编辑器创建的“立即购买”按钮时,会出现两个选项:“使用我的PayPal帐户支付”或“创建一个PayPal帐户”。并没有不用创建PayPal帐户的支付选项。

我不想强制买家注册PayPal帐户并填写大量字段。卡号、过期日期、CVC以及可能的名字和姓氏-这就是必要且足够的信息。如何实现这一点?


你好,你成功让你的客户使用信用卡支付而无需创建账户了吗? - Ivan
@Ivan 你好。是的,这确实与账户所有者所属的国家有关。正如你从PP_MTS_Chad的回答中看到的那样,国家列表是“PayPal的秘密”,并没有在任何地方公布。加拿大肯定在这个列表中,因此加拿大注册的账户需要选择一个选项。 - Andrey Regentov
3个回答

15
如果您所在的国家支持买家使用信用卡而不需要PayPal账户支付,您只需要在您的账户中启用“PayPal账户可选”功能即可。
您可以登录您的账户,并进入个人资料页面。
然后,您需要转到您的“网站付款首选项”页面。根据您的账户类型,此项可能位于您的“销售工具”下面。
进入“网站付款首选项”页面后,您需要将“PayPal账户可选”设置为“开启”。这样一来,您的买家就可以只使用信用卡进行支付。
请注意,该功能仅适用于支持的国家。此外,您的电子邮件地址必须已确认且不能设置订阅、定期付款或账单协议。

你能提供一下你正在设置的账户的电子邮件地址吗? - PP_MTS_Chad
不,StackOverflow没有私信功能,我不想在公共场合发布电子邮件。你在StackOverflow上看到一个名字,我在PayPal配置文件中也有同样的名字。 - Andrey Regentov
1
请问您能解释一下原因吗?国家列表中包含“总付款解决方案”作为国家,因此国家不是原因。文档表明,“Premier”账户应该具有该功能,因此账户类型也不是原因。嗯...难道PayPal没有公布某些标准吗? - Andrey Regentov
这是在假设我查找的账户是正确的情况下。只有一个账户,所以我认为它是正确的。您所提到的列表是特别针对哪些国家可以发送和接收付款的。这不是一个专门列出哪些国家只能向其买家提供使用信用卡支付选项的列表。目前网站上没有列出这些国家的清单。至于为什么某些国家没有这种能力,我没有具体的信息。 - PP_MTS_Chad
1
你好,我有同样的问题 - 我花了几天时间为我的客户集成PayPal付款,为他们提供不需要PayPal账户也可以支付的选项。许多老年客户不知道如何开设PayPal账户,因此我理解我可以在我的商业账户中使用此功能。我来自斯洛伐克/斯洛伐克共和国。这对斯洛伐克也适用吗?为什么我不能接受信用卡而不开设PayPal账户?如果这是真的,那么PayPal实际上正在误导全球数百万人。应该提供支持的国家列表。谢谢解释。 - lubosdz
显示剩余3条评论

8
我花了一些时间与Paypal客户技术和商业支持团队交流: 他们表示出于安全原因,Paypal标准版不再支持未创建Paypal账户的付款。
目前,唯一的方式是使用Paypal快速结帐和Paypal Pro。
可能这个功能也会从Paypal快速结帐中删除。
更新:
在处理其他Paypal账户时,我发现被告知的内容并不总是正确的。有时允许进行无需创建账户的付款。这取决于几个因素,例如业务账户的年龄或交易数量。我认为最终只是业务账户的信誉问题。

2
那么为什么这个页面还在呢?链接 - Andrey Regentov
2
这是一个非常好的问题。特别是因为还有其他页面在谈论这个问题。我认为Paypal在任何事情上都不是很清楚...事实是,在我使用过的所有网站上,没有Paypal标准账户的付款方式已经消失了(有好几个),而在Paypal快速结账的网站上仍然存在。关于你链接的页面,我只能说它似乎与一些eBay结账页面有关...也许答案就在这里,但很抱歉我对eBay并不了解。 - bluantinoo
4
出于安全原因,他们只是想增加用户来提升股票。 - JustinBieber
1
现在在意大利,即使使用PP Express Checkout支付,也需要PP账户。 - bluantinoo
最终,如果您想接受PayPal和信用卡,那么您需要完全不同的解决方案来处理信用卡,比如另一个支付网关或其他什么东西? - Cec
你可以使用Paypal,但你必须开通Paypal PRO账户 https://www.paypal.com/it/webapps/mpp/hosted - bluantinoo

1
我知道这是一个较旧的帖子,但我遇到了完全相同的情况,在搜索了几天后,我终于找到了解决快速结账中未出现访客结账的方法。
我基本上必须创建一个PayPal Express Checkout应用程序。
最终结果比我预期的要容易得多。以下是我遵循的步骤:
1)我登录到我的PayPal帐户,并在此处创建paypal应用程序:https://developer.paypal.com/developer/applications/create 我保存了创建的沙盒和生产客户端ID值,稍后需要它们
2)然后我将checkout.js脚本添加到我的结账页面:
PayPal建议引用他们的脚本而不是将本地副本下载到您的项目中。
3)接下来,我在这里帮助创建我需要的javascript以供我的结账页面使用:https://developer.paypal.com/demo/checkout/#/pattern/client,我使用客户端REST,然后将其粘贴到我的结账页面中。我使用第1步中创建的客户端ID更新了沙盒和生产客户端ID值。

4) 我在页面上添加了一个隐藏变量:包括运费在内的总金额,我从后台代码中设置了这个变量。我知道还有其他方法可以实现,但我是一个习惯性的人。 :)

5) 然后,在生成的javascript中,我不再使用硬编码的金额,而是从隐藏的输入对象中获取金额值:amount: {total: amount.value, currency: 'USD'}

现在,当客户进入我的结账页面时,我会显示一个漂亮的数据网格/表格,显示他们的订单详情和包含运费的总价。当他们点击“使用Paypal结账”按钮时,Paypal会为我执行快速结账,完成交易。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接